From 3129566a1c37d9ac7127fbbb93c38f7d28115e4b Mon Sep 17 00:00:00 2001 From: Vladimir Hodakov Date: Sat, 31 Mar 2018 10:05:59 +0400 Subject: [PATCH] Fix bot failure on 10th grade hands in profiles --- lib/users/parsers.go |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/lib/users/parsers.go b/lib/users/parsers.go index 0190916..83d0fd8 100644 --- a/lib/users/parsers.go +++ b/lib/users/parsers.go @@ -175,7 +175,11 @@ func (u *Users) ParseProfile(update *tgbotapi.Update, playerRaw *dbmapping.Playe pkName := strings.Split(pokememeString, "+")[0] pkName = strings.Replace(pkName, " ⭐", "", 1) pkName = strings.TrimSuffix(pkName, " ") - pkName = strings.Split(pkName, "⃣ ")[1] + if strings.Contains(pkName, "🔟") { + pkName = strings.Split(pkName, "🔟 ")[1] + } else { + pkName = strings.Split(pkName, "⃣ ")[1] + } pokememes[strconv.Itoa(pi)+"_"+pkName] = pkAttack powerInt += c.Statistics.GetPoints(pkAttack) }